22: # This shell script produces a header file which the gcc driver
23: # program uses to pick which library to use based on the machine
24: # specific options that it is given.
25:
26: # The first argument is a list of sets of options. The elements in
27: # the list are separated by spaces. Within an element, the options
28: # are separated by slashes. No leading dash is used on the options.
29: # Each option in a set is mutually incompatible with all other options
30: # in the set.
31:
32: # The optional second argument is a list of subdirectory names. If
33: # the second argument is non-empty, there must be as many elements in
34: # the second argument as there are options in the first argument. The
35: # elements in the second list are separated by spaces. If the second
36: # argument is empty, the option names will be used as the directory
37: # names.
38:
39: # The optional third argument is a list of options which are
40: # identical. The elements in the list are separated by spaces. Each
41: # element must be of the form OPTION=OPTION. The first OPTION should
42: # appear in the first argument, and the second should be a synonym for
1.1.1.2 ! root 43: # it. Question marks are replaced with equal signs in both options.
1.1 root 44:
45: # The output looks like
46: # #define MULTILIB_MATCHES "\
47: # SUBDIRECTORY OPTIONS;\
48: # ...
49: # "
50: # The SUBDIRECTORY is the subdirectory to use. The OPTIONS are
51: # multiple options separated by spaces. Each option may start with an
52: # exclamation point. gcc will consider each line in turn. If none of
53: # the options beginning with an exclamation point are present, and all
54: # of the other options are present, that subdirectory will be used.
55: # The order of the subdirectories is such that they can be created in
56: # order; that is, a subdirectory is preceded by all its parents.
57:
58: # Here is a example (this is simplified from the actual 680x0 case):
59: # genmultilib "m68000/m68020 msoft-float" "m68000 m68020 msoft-float"
60: # "m68000=mc68000"
61: # This produces:
1.1.1.2 ! root 62: # #define MULTILIB_SELECT "\
1.1 root 63: # . !m68000 !mc68000 !m68020 !msoft-float;\
1.1.1.2 ! root 64: # m68000 m68000 !m68020 !msoft-float;\
! 65: # m68000 mc60000 !m68020 !msoft-float;\
! 66: # m68020 !m68000 !mc68000 m68020 !msoft-float;\
! 67: # msoft-float !m68000 !mc68000 !m68020 msoft-float;\
! 68: # m68000/msoft-float m68000 !m68020 msoft-float;\
! 69: # m68000/msoft-float mc68000 !m68020 msoft-float;\
! 70: # m68020/msoft-float !m68000 !mc68000 m68020 msoft-float;\
1.1 root 71: # "
72: # The effect is that `gcc -msoft-float' (for example) will append
73: # msoft-float to the directory name when searching for libraries or
74: # startup files, and `gcc -m68000 -msoft-float' (for example) will
75: # append m68000/msoft-float.

77: # Copy the positional parameters into variables.
78: options=$1
79: dirnames=$2
80: matches=$3
81:
82: # What we want to do is select all combinations of the sets in
83: # options. Each combination which includes a set of mutually
84: # exclusive options must then be output multiple times, once for each
85: # item in the set. Selecting combinations is a recursive process.
86: # Since not all versions of sh support functions, we achieve recursion
87: # by creating a temporary shell script which invokes itself.
88: rm -f tmpmultilib
89: cat >tmpmultilib <<\EOF
90: #!/bin/sh
91: # This recursive script basically outputs all combinations of its
92: # input arguments, handling mutually exclusive sets of options by
93: # repetition. When the script is called, ${initial} is the list of
94: # options which should appear before all combinations this will
95: # output. The output looks like a list of subdirectory names with
96: # leading and trailing slashes.
97: if [ "$#" != "0" ]; then
98: first=$1
99: shift
100: for opt in `echo $first | sed -e 's|/| |'g`; do
101: echo ${initial}${opt}/
102: done
103: ./tmpmultilib $@
104: for opt in `echo $first | sed -e 's|/| |'g`; do
105: initial="${initial}${opt}/" ./tmpmultilib $@
106: done
107: fi
108: EOF
109: chmod +x tmpmultilib
110:
111: combinations=`initial=/ ./tmpmultilib ${options}`
112:
113: rm -f tmpmultilib
114:
115: # Construct a sed pattern which will convert option names to directory
116: # names.
117: todirnames=
118: if [ -n "${dirnames}" ]; then
119: set x ${dirnames}
120: shift
121: for set in ${options}; do
122: for opt in `echo ${set} | sed -e 's|/| |'g`; do
123: if [ "$1" != "${opt}" ]; then
124: todirnames="${todirnames} -e s|/${opt}/|/${1}/|g"
125: fi
126: shift
127: done
128: done
129: fi
130:
131: # Construct a sed pattern which will add negations based on the
132: # matches. The semicolons are easier than getting the shell to accept
133: # quoted spaces when expanding a variable.
134: matchnegations=
135: for i in ${matches}; do
1.1.1.2 ! root 136: l=`echo $i | sed -e 's/=.*$//' -e 's/?/=/g'`
! 137: r=`echo $i | sed -e 's/^.*=//' -e 's/?/=/g'`
1.1 root 138: matchnegations="${matchnegations} -e s/;!${l};/;!${l};!${r};/"
139: done
140:
141: # We need another recursive shell script to correctly handle positive
142: # matches. If we are invoked as
143: # genmultilib "opt1 opt2" "" "opt1=nopt1 opt2=nopt2"
144: # we must output
145: # opt1/opt2 opt1 opt2
146: # opt1/opt2 nopt1 opt2
147: # opt1/opt2 opt1 nopt2
148: # opt1/opt2 nopt1 nopt2
149: # In other words, we must output all combinations of matches.
150: rm -f tmpmultilib2
151: cat >tmpmultilib2 <<\EOF
152: #!/bin/sh
153: # The positional parameters are a list of matches to consider.
154: # ${dirout} is the directory name and ${optout} is the current list of
155: # options.
156: if [ "$#" = "0" ]; then
157: echo "${dirout} ${optout};\\"
158: else
159: first=$1
160: shift
161: dirout="${dirout}" optout="${optout}" ./tmpmultilib2 $@
1.1.1.2 ! root 162: l=`echo ${first} | sed -e 's/=.*$//' -e 's/?/=/g'`
! 163: r=`echo ${first} | sed -e 's/^.*=//' -e 's/?/=/g'`
! 164: if expr " ${optout} " : ".* ${l} .*" > /dev/null; then
1.1 root 165: newopt=`echo " ${optout} " | sed -e "s/ ${l} / ${r} /" -e 's/^ //' -e 's/ $//'`
166: dirout="${dirout}" optout="${newopt}" ./tmpmultilib2 $@
1.1.1.2 ! root 167: fi
1.1 root 168: fi
169: EOF
170: chmod +x tmpmultilib2
171:
172: # We are ready to start output.
173: echo '#define MULTILIB_SELECT "\'
174:
175: # Start with the current directory, which includes only negations.
176: optout=
177: for set in ${options}; do
178: for opt in `echo ${set} | sed -e 's|/| |'g`; do
179: optout="${optout} !${opt}"
180: done
181: done
182: optout=`echo ${optout} | sed -e 's/^ //'`
183: if [ -n "${matchnegations}" ]; then
184: optout=`echo ";${optout};" | sed -e 's/ /;/g' ${matchnegations} -e 's/^;//' -e 's/;$//' -e 's/;/ /g'`
185: fi
186: echo ". ${optout};\\"
187:
188: # Work over the list of combinations. We have to translate each one
189: # to use the directory names rather than the option names, we have to
190: # include the information in matches, and we have to generate the
191: # correct list of options and negations.
192: for combo in ${combinations}; do
193: # Use the directory names rather than the option names.
194: if [ -n "${todirnames}" ]; then
195: dirout=`echo ${combo} | sed ${todirnames}`
196: else
197: dirout=${combo}
198: fi
199: # Remove the leading and trailing slashes.
200: dirout=`echo ${dirout} | sed -e 's|^/||' -e 's|/$||g'`
201:
202: # Look through the options. We must output each option that is
1.1.1.2 ! root 203: # present, and negate each option that is not present.
1.1 root 204: optout=
205: for set in ${options}; do
206: setopts=`echo ${set} | sed -e 's|/| |g'`
207: for opt in ${setopts}; do
1.1.1.2 ! root 208: if expr "${combo} " : ".*/${opt}/.*" > /dev/null; then
1.1 root 209: optout="${optout} ${opt}"
1.1.1.2 ! root 210: else
1.1 root 211: optout="${optout} !${opt}"
1.1.1.2 ! root 212: fi
! 213: done
1.1 root 214: done
215: optout=`echo ${optout} | sed -e 's/^ //'`
216:
217: # Add any negations of matches.
218: if [ -n "${matchnegations}" ]; then
219: optout=`echo ";${optout};" | sed -e 's/ /;/g' ${matchnegations} -e 's/^;//' -e 's/;$//' -e 's/;/ /g'`
220: fi
221:
222: # Output the line with all appropriate matches.
223: dirout="${dirout}" optout="${optout}" ./tmpmultilib2 ${matches}
224: done
225:
226: rm -f tmpmultilib2
227:
228: # That's it.
229: echo '"'
230:
